Flyaway (Nutshell album)

1977 studio album by Nutshell From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

"Flyaway" is the title of the second album by the Christian trio Nutshell.[1]

Track listing

Side one

  1. "Walking into the Wind"
  2. "Sara"
  3. "Moonlight"
  4. "Conversation Pieces"
  5. "Flyaway"

Side two

  1. "Feel Like a River"
  2. "Safe and Sound"
  3. "For Each Other"
  4. "Bedsitter / Sometimes"

all songs by Paul Field

Personnel

  • Paul Field -vocals, guitar, piano
  • Pam Thiele - vocals, autoharp
  • Heather Barlow - vocals
  • Mike Giles - drums
  • John G. Perry - bass
  • Rod Edwards - piano, electric piano, clavinet, synthesizer
  • Tony Carr - percussion

Production notes

  • Produced by Jon Miller, Rod Edwards and Roger Hand
  • Engineered by Dave Harris
  • Re-mix engineer Roger Wake
  • Recorded at Sound Associates Studios, London, Morgan Studios, London
